Incentives offered to new and existing betters are often used as means of exploitation by threat actors. The industry has seen a sharp surge in bonus abuse fraud, card/chargeback, promo code fraud, chip dumping, where sensitive information or accounts of the players are misused (through phishing or other social engineering tactics) for financial gains.

Cybercriminals frequently engage in fork bets or arbitrage betting as a strategy to guarantee profits, irrespective of the game's outcome. This tactic involves strategically placing bets on all possible outcomes of an event either done through using multiple betting accounts from different bookmakers.

Fraudsters create multiple accounts or illegaly obtain login details of legitimate users for account takeover fraud to acquire big payoffs through exploiting sign-up, referral bonuses, transfer points, event ticks, voucher, offers and more.
The accounts can also be turned into a big network of mule accounts, serving the purpose of money laundering.
